Job Description

Ainsley Search Group is working with a leading privately held beverage manufacturer in South Jersey to identify a hands-on Regional Safety Manager to drive a strong safety culture across multiple production sites. This individual will be a key member of the EHS leadership team, reporting directly to the VP of Environmental, Health & Safety.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ead all safety programs and initiatives across manufacturing and distribution facilities in the region.
  • Develop and standardize safety policies, procedures, and performance metrics (KPIs); build alignment across plant leadership.
  • Ensure strict adherence to OSHA standards and maintain awareness of evolving regulations to keep compliance measures up to date.
  • Own workers’ compensation case management, including injury documentation, root cause analysis, and follow-up with insurance carriers and third-party providers.
  • Conduct site safety audits and risk assessments; lead safety committee meetings and plant-level engagement to reinforce a culture of safety.
  • Deliver safety training and toolbox talks; provide on-the-floor coaching and mentoring to operations leaders and frontline staff.
  • Oversee compliance for PPE programs, equipment safety inspections, and emergency response protocols.
  • Lead industrial hygiene testing (noise, air quality, exposure) and manage corrective action plans where applicable.
  • Partner with HR and operations teams to manage incident response, reporting, and corrective actions.

What We’re Looking For: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Occupational Health & Safety or a related field.
  • Several years of experience in multi-site safety leadership within a manufacturing, distribution, or logistics setting.
  • Working knowledge of OSHA regulations and injury/illness recordkeeping requirements.
  • Proven track record managing workers’ compensation and safety training programs.
  • Strong communication and leadership skills with the ability to influence and collaborate across functions.
  • CSP or other safety certification is a plus, but not required.
  • Food or chemical manufacturing industry experience is a plus.
